Understanding Pet dog Behavior

Pets connect mainly via habits. A wagging tail may show happiness, while abrupt changes in actions could signify distress. Common signs include:

Vocalizations: Grumbling, barking, or grumbling may show discomfort. Body Language: Tail position, ear positioning, and pose can mirror emotional states. Physical Signs and symptoms: Excessive licking or scraping could suggest allergic reactions or injuries.

Recognizing these actions is the very first step towards ensuring your pet dog's health.

Essential Family Items for Pet Dog First Aid

Creating a portable kit filled with crucial household items is a superb method for any type of animal owner. Right here are some must-have things:

Gauze and Bandages: For applying stress to wounds. Antiseptic Wipes: To tidy minor cuts or scrapes. Tweezers: For getting rid of splinters or ticks. Thermometer: A digital thermostat especially meant for family pets helps monitor their temperature. Pet-Safe Painkiller: Always speak with a veterinarian before carrying out any type of medication.

These items will can be found in useful throughout emergencies and daily crashes alike.

Recognizing Signs Throughout Bushfire Season

Bushfires position one-of-a-kind challenges not just for humans but likewise for family pets. Smoke breathing can bring about severe breathing concerns amongst pets:

Warning Indicators Include:

Coughing or wheezing Lethargy Irritated eyes

If you observe these signs throughout bushfire season, take prompt action by relocating them indoors and getting in touch with a vet if necessary.

Fire Extinguisher Procedure: Keeping You and Your Family pets Safe

Understanding just how to operate a fire extinguisher can save lives-- both human and animal alike:

Pull the Pin Aim Low Squeeze the Handle Sweep Side to Side

Keep fire extinguishers accessible throughout your home so you're prepared in instance of emergencies including both individuals and pets.

FAQ 2: Just how can I tell if my cat is distressed?

Answer: Cats reveal distress with adjustments in actions such as concealing away, too much pet grooming, anorexia nervosa, or articulations like yowling or growling.

FAQ 3: Is it secure to utilize human medications on pets?

Answer: No! Lots of human drugs are toxic to family pets; constantly speak with a vet prior to providing any drug meant for humans.

FAQ 4: What are common indicators my dog might be overheating?

Answer: Indicators include excessive panting, salivating exceedingly, lethargy, vomiting or diarrhea; relocate them inside immediately if you presume overheating!

FAQ 5: Just how often ought to I check my pet's emergency treatment kit?

Answer: It's suggested to review your family pet's emergency treatment kit every 6 months-- guarantee all products are intact and within expiration dates!
